Linux网络操作系统与实训(第三版)
上QQ阅读APP看书,第一时间看更新

2.2 Red Hat Enterprise Linux 6.4的安装

在安装前需要对虚拟机软件进行介绍。启动VMWare软件,在VMWare Workstation主窗口中单击“New Virtual Machine”,或者选择“File”→“New”→“Virtual Machine”命令,打开新建虚拟机向导。继续单击“下一步”按钮,出现如图2-2所示对话框。从VMWare 6.5开始,在建立虚拟机时有一项“Easy install”,类似Windows的无人值守安装,如果不希望执行“Easy install”,请选择第3项“我以后再安装操作系统”单选按钮(推荐选择本项)。其他内容请参照网上资料。

图2-2 在虚拟机中选择安装方式

1.设置启动顺序

决定了要采用的启动方式后,就要到BIOS中进行设置,将相关的启动设备设置为高优先级。因为现在所有的Linux版本都支持从光盘启动,所以进入“Advanced BIOS Feature”选项,设置第一个引导设备为“CDROM”。

一般情况下,计算机的硬盘是启动计算机的第一选择,也就是说计算机在开机自检后,将首先读取硬盘上引导扇区中的程序来启动计算机。要安装RHEL 6首先要确认计算机将光盘设置为第一启动设备。开启计算机电源后,屏幕会出现计算机硬件的检测信息,此时根据屏幕提示按下相应的按键进入BIOS的设置画面,如屏幕出现“Press DEL to enter SETUP”字样,那么按【Delete】键就可进入BIOS设置画面。不同的计算机提示信息有所不同,不同主板的计算机BIOS设置画面也有所差别。

在BIOS设置画面中将系统启动顺序中的第一启动设备设置为CD-ROM选项,并保存设置,退出BIOS。

2.选择安装方式

把RHEL 6安装光盘放入光驱,重新启动计算机,稍等片刻,就看到了经典的安装界面,如图2-3所示。

图2-3 选择RHEL 6安装模式

RHEL 6的安装欢迎界面和RHEL 5有点区别,RHEL 6分4个选项,第一个是安装或者升级一个存在的系统,第二个是安装基本的视频驱动系统,第三个是救援模式安装系统,第四个是从本地磁盘启动。光盘安装界面中按键【Tab】用于编辑,【Enter】键用于执行,上下方向键用于移动光标。

3.检测光盘和硬件

选中第一项,直接按【Enter】键,安装程序就会自动检测硬件,并且会在屏幕上显示相关信息,如光盘、硬盘、CPU、串行设备等,如图2-4所示。

图2-4 RHEL 6安装程序检测硬件中

检测完毕后,还会出现一个光盘检测窗口,如图2-5所示。这是因为大家使用的Linux很多都是从网上下载的,为了防止下载错误导致安装失败,RHEL 6特意设置了光盘正确性检查程序。如果确认自己的光盘没有问题,可单击“Skip”按钮跳过漫长的检测过程。

图2-5 选择是否检测光盘介质

4.选择安装语言并进行键盘设置

如果主机硬件都可以很好地被RHEL 6支持,则进入图形化安装阶段。首先打开的是欢迎界面,如图2-6所示,RHEL 6的安装可以通过简单的选择来一步一步地完成。

RHEL 6的国际化做得相当好,它的安装界面内置了数十种语言支持。根据自己的需求选择语言种类,这里选择“简体中文”,如图2-7所示,单击“Next”按钮后,整个安装界面就变成简体中文显示了。

图2-6 RHEL 6的欢迎界面

图2-7 选择所采用的语言

接下来是键盘布局选择窗口,对于选择了“简体中文”界面的用户来说,这里最好选择“美国英语式”,如图2-8所示。

图2-8 选择适合自己的键盘布局

5.选择系统使用的存储设备

一般情况,默认选择“基本存储设备”单选按钮,如图2-9所示,再单击“下一步”按钮。

图2-9 选择系统使用的存储设备

出现如图2-10所示的提示信息时,单击“是,忽略所有数据”按钮。

图2-10 存储设备警告

6.设置计算机名

可根据实际情况,对计算机主机名进行命名,如RHEL 6.4-1,如图2-11所示。

图2-11 为计算机命名

7.配置网络

单击界面左下角的“配置网络”按钮,进入配置服务器网络界面,选中“System eth0”,然后单击“编辑”按钮,可以给eth0配置静态IP地址,如图2-12所示。

8.选择系统时区

单击“关闭”按钮,回到图2-11,单击“下一步”按钮,出现如图2-13所示的时区选择界面。时区默认为“亚洲/上海”,注意需要取消选中“系统时钟使用UTC时间”复选框,然后单击“下一步”按钮。

图2-12 配置网络

图2-13 设置时区

9.设置root账号密码

设置根账号密码是RHEL 6安装过程中最重要的一步。根用户类似于Windows中的Administrator(管理员)账号,对于系统来说具有最高权限。如图2-14所示,建议输入一个复杂组合的密码,密码可包含大写字母、小写字母、数字、符号。

图2-14 为根用户设置一个健壮的密码

注意:如果想在安装好RHEL 6之后重新设置根账号密码,需要在命令行控制台下输入“system-config-rootpassword”指令。

10.为硬盘分区

磁盘分区允许用户将一个磁盘划分成几个单独的部分,每一部分有自己的盘符。在分区之前,首先规划分区。以40GB硬盘为例,作如下规划:

·/boot分区大小为300MB;

·swap分区大小为4GB;

·/分区大小为10GB;

·/usr分区大小为8GB;

·/home分区大小为8GB;

·/var分区大小为8GB;

·/tmp分区大小为1GB。

下面进行具体分区操作。

RHEL 6在安装向导中提供了一个简单易用的分区程序(Disk Druid)来帮助用户完成分区操作。在此选择“创建自定义布局”单选按钮,使用分区工具手动在所选设备中创建自定义布局,如图2-15所示。

图2-15 选择安装类型

单击“下一步”按钮,出现如图2-16所示的“请选择源驱动器”对话框。

图2-16 请选择源驱动器

①创建boot分区(启动分区)。单击“创建”按钮,会出现如图2-17所示的“生成存储”对话框,在该对话框中单击“创建”按钮,出现如图2-18所示的“添加分区”对话框。在“挂载点”下拉列表框选择“/boot”,磁盘文件系统类型就选择标准的“ext4”,大小设置为300MB(在“大小”框中输入300,单位是MB),其他的按照默认设置即可。

图2-17 “生成存储”对话框

图2-18 “添加分区”对话框

②创建交换分区。同样的,单击“创建”按钮,此时会出现同样的对话框,只需要在“文件系统类型”中选择“swap”,大小设置为物理内存的两倍即可。比如,若计算机物理内存大小为2GB,设置的swap分区大小就是4096MB(4GB)。

说明:简单地说,swap就是虚拟内存分区,它类似于Windows的PageFile.sys页面交换文件。就是当计算机的物理内存不够时,作为后备利用硬盘上的指定空间来动态扩充内存的大小。

③同样,创建“/”分区大小为10GB,“/usr”分区大小为8GB,“/home”分区大小为8GB,“/var”分区大小为8GB,“/tmp”分区大小为1GB。

特别注意:

①不可与root分区分开的目录是:/dev、/etc、/sbin、/bin和/lib。系统启动时,核心只载入一个分区,那就是“/”,核心启动要加载/dev、/etc、/sbin、/bin和/lib这5个目录的程序,所以以上几个目录必须和/根目录在一起。

②最好单独分区的目录是:/home、/usr、/var和/tmp,出于安全和管理的目的,以上4个目录最好独立出来,比如在samba服务中,/home目录可以配置磁盘配额quota,在sendmail服务中,/var目录可以配置磁盘配额quota。

④在创建分区时,/boot、/、swap分区都选中“强制为主分区”选项,建立独立主分区(/dev/sda2-3)。/home、/usr、/var和/tmp这4个目录分别挂载到/dev/sda5-8四个独立逻辑分区(扩展分区/dev/sda4被分成若干逻辑分区)。分区完成后的结果如图2-19所示。

提示:我们预留了部分空间没做任何分区,在第6章中会用到。

⑤单击“下一步”按钮继续。出现如图2-20所示的“格式化警告”对话框,单击“格式化”按钮出现如图2-21所示的“将存储配置写入磁盘”对话框。

图2-19 完成分区后的结果

图2-20 “格式化警告”对话框

图2-21 “将存储配置写入磁盘”对话框

⑥确认分区无误后,单击“将修改写入磁盘”按钮,这里只有一个硬盘,保持默认,如图2-22所示。直接单击“下一步”按钮继续。

图2-22 选择写入磁盘的存储设备

11.开始安装软件

①出现选择安装软件组的对话框,如图2-23所示。这里选择“基本服务器”单选按钮,并选择“现在自定义”单选按钮,然后单击“下一步”按钮。

图2-23 选择安装软件组

各选项包含的软件如下:

·基本服务器:安装的基本系统的平台支持,不包括桌面。

·数据库服务器:基本系统平台,加上MySQL和PostgreSQL数据库,无桌面。

·万维网服务器:基本系统平台,加上PHP、Web Server,还有MySQL和PostgreSQL数据库的客户端,无桌面。

·身份管理服务器:加入身份管理。

·虚拟化主机:基本系统加虚拟化平台。

·桌面:基本的桌面系统,包括常用的桌面软件,如文档查看工具。

·软件开发工作站:包含的软件包较多,包括基本系统、虚拟化平台、桌面环境、开发工具。

·最小:基本的系统,不含有任何可选的软件包。

②出现“选择软件包”对话框。选中“基本系统”选项,如图2-24所示,取消选中“Java平台”复选框。再选中“桌面”选项,如图2-25所示,选中除KDE外的所有桌面选项。

图2-24 基本系统

图2-25 桌面

特别注意:如果不选择“桌面”中的选项,安装完成后,不会出现图形界面,只会出现命令终端。

12.安装完成

进入安装软件阶段,等所选软件全部安装完成后,出现安装完成的祝贺界面,如图2-26所示。单击“重新引导”按钮则重新引导计算机,启动新安装的Linux。

图2-26 安装完成的祝贺界面

至此,RHEL 6安装完成。